Comprehending African Greys
Qualities and Traits
African Greys are medium-sized parrots mainly found in Central Africa. They vary in shades of grey and have striking red tail feathers, with a typical life-span varying from 40 to 60 years in captivity. Here are some prominent qualities of blue african grey parrot Greys:
- Cognition: Renowned for their cognitive abilities, african grey parrots for adoption Greys possess the intellectual capability comparable to that of a kid. They can fix puzzles, learn languages, and form strong bonds with their owners.
- Social Needs: These birds are extremely social and flourish in interactive environments. They need daily engagement and psychological stimulation to prevent dullness and behavioral issues.
- Singing Abilities: Known as one of the finest mimics in the bird world, African Greys can imitate sounds, expressions, and even emotional tones.

Getting ready for Adoption
Before embracing an African Grey, it is crucial to prepare properly. Here are some vital considerations:
Initial Setup
- Cage Requirements: African Greys need roomy, strong cages that enable for flight and motion. The minimum dimensions for a cage should be 24" width x 24" depth x 36" height.
- Environment: Create a comfy environment with toys and enrichment activities that promote their minds.
- Diet: A well-balanced diet plan rich in pellets, fresh fruits, and veggies is necessary for their health.
Time Commitment
- Understand that female african grey parrot Greys need daily interaction and socializing. They grow on bonding with their owners, so substantial time should be assigned to play and engagement.
Taking care of an African Grey
Proper care is essential for the well-being of an African Grey. Here are key aspects to think about:
Dietary Needs
Establish a nutritious diet that includes:
- High-quality pellets
- Fresh fruits and veggies (avoid avocado and chocolate as they are harmful)
- Nuts and seeds in moderation
Social Interaction
- Spend time appealing with your bird daily through social activities, training, and playtime. This interaction is essential for mental health and social bonding.
Health Check-Ups
- Set up routine veterinary check-ups to monitor your bird's health and catch any possible problems early on.
Frequently Asked Questions About African Greys for Adoption
1. What is the average lifespan of an African Grey?
African Greys usually live between 40 to 60 years, often longer with appropriate care.
2. Are African Greys excellent animals for households with children?
Yes, African Greys can be terrific animals for households, but interactions ought to be supervised, specifically with more youthful kids, as their social requirements can in some cases cause frustration.
3. Do African Greys require a lot of attention?
Yes, African Greys require significant social interaction and psychological stimulation; they can establish behavioral issues if neglected.
4. Can African Greys find out to talk?
Definitely! African Greys are remarkable mimics and can discover a comprehensive vocabulary.
5. What prevail health concerns for African Greys?
Common health concerns include plume plucking, respiratory illness, and dietary shortages. Regular check-ups can assist avoid these issues.
